Tech Sector Drop Led Pullback in Major Indices: An In-Depth Analysis
In August 2025, major stock indices experienced a notable pullback, driven by a significant decline in the tech sector. The “tech sector drop” has become a focal point for investors and analysts, as technology stocks, which had been leading market…